The 1804 Silver Dollar is one of the most famous coins in the world. It is known for its rarity and its fascinating history. Despite the 1804 date, no silver dollars were made in that year. The 1804 Silver Dollar was actually struck in the 1830s and later, to be used as presentation pieces, diplomatic gifts, and possibly to complete coin sets.

The entire first-year production of Draped Bust silver dollars took place in the last two weeks of October, 1795 and totaled a modest 42,738 pieces. That’s barely one-fourth the mintage of 1795 Flowing Hair dollars; some 160,000 of those had been struck earlier.The Draped Bust dollar is a United States dollar coin minted from 1795 to 1803, and was reproduced, dated 1804, into the 1850s. The design succeeded the Flowing Hair dollar, which began mintage in 1794 and was the first silver dollar struck by the United States Mint.The story of the 1804 Draped Bust dollar is draped in mystery, especially when the illegally minted Class II and Class III coins are concerned. It is a generally accepted truth that the Mint recovered all but one of the illegal Draped Bust dollars. Overall, it is believed that only 15 examples of these coins are accounted for and exist …

Late in 1795, the Draped Bust dollar design by Robert Scot replaced his former Flowing Hair motif that became the first design on any official United States silver dollar. The Draped Bust design, like the Flowing Hair type, represents a visage of Miss Liberty.No 1804 dollars were struck before the 1830s, and 1804 dollars were restruck in 1858 and later. These tend to be categorized with backdated 1801, 1802 and 1803 Draped Bust, Heraldic Eagle silver dollars that were specially struck at times that are currently unknown, though probably not before 1858. This makes it easy to spot a fake as any wear at all would be an obvious tell that it is a fake coin.Large Eagle Bust dollars were minted from 1798 through 1803. In later years, “restrike” pieces were produced dated 1804 as were Proof restrikes from new dies bearing the dates 1801, 1802 and 1803. Among business strikes, examples most often encountered are apt to be dated 1798 or 1799. Those dated 1800 are scarcer, while those dated from ...
